25 Years ago in Tenterden - July 2000
From the Tenterden Archives
Researched by Jack Gillett

July 2000
 
  • Age Concern Helping Hands in Tenterden has been given a helping hand in the shape of £503 from Keith and Gay Newton who completed an 11-mile walk in poor weather
  • The thought of a sizzling breakfast of sausages and bacon kept eight youngsters who are members of ACE (the St Mildred’s Church’s Sunday morning youth group) going during a dark and breezy night in St Mildred’s Church tower in Tenterden
  • Tenterden Tigers footballers were roaring at the weekend, reaching two finals at the Broad Oak Tournament
  • Happy horticulturalists Betty Chambers, David Barnes and Seb Wells were three of the winners at the Tenterden and District show
  • The Ellen Terry Theatre Club staged Mrs Shakespeare on four days at the Barn Theatre
  • Every day of the month guided tours of Tenterden Vineyard Park were held at noon, 2pm and 3pm
  • When the Duke of Gloucester visited Tenterden to officially open the Kent and East Sussex extension which runs down to Bodiam, he jumped at the chance to guide the train the few hundred yards across the level crossing
  • A crunch meeting on the Tesco supermarket road access scheme in Tenterden was held
  • A plan to build a block of nine flats on the former gas-works site in Bridewell Lane, Tenterden, has been recommended for refusal by the town council
  • Six green and striped tents went up in Tenterden for the town’s first farmers’ market
  • Tenterden Operatic and Dramatic Society is to offer members of the audience a glass of wine at its performances
  • Fire safety rules have put a damper on plans to light a beacon on top of St Mildred’s Church tower, Tenterden, to celebrate the Queen Mother’s 100th birthday
  • A cricket match will be played between the Mayor’s XI and Tenterden Cricket Club during its coming festival week
  • Repairs to vandalised areas of the Tenterden and St Michaels recreation grounds will cost council taxpayers more than £2000 in the next month
  • The Tenterden leisure centre is shaping up with a £500,000 refit this summer
  • A wooden bench, with two silver birches, has been dedicated in memory of school governor Robin Coombs, at Tenterden Junior School
  • Rotarians from Caen in Normandy joined their counterparts from the Tenterden club on a night out in London, to celebrate a 40-year friendship between the two clubs
  • All primary school children living in Tenterden and St Michaels were invited to meet the mayor, Cllr Jill Kirk, in Tenterden town hall and collect commemorative Millennium mugs
  • The West View Hospital £4.4m development project in Tenterden is making progress behind the scenes
